Synopsis

Solidarity show
to support cancer research
of the Human Health Foundation Onlus


It will be Diego Moreno who will animate the fundraising event Human Health Foundation Onlus, the ethical partner of the 53rd edition of Festival dei Due Mondi.
The Italian-Argentinian artist, who has lived in Italy since 1991, is one of the most original interpreters of this sensual art that gives authentic shivers of emotion to the audience. Lyrics and music that speak directly to the heart and Neapolitan song classics interpreted in Spanish: these are some of the key ingredients of Tango Scugnizzo. Not to be missed is the intense interpretation of the adventurous opera existential and artistic Don Carlos Gardel sacred monster of Tango whose voice has been declared a World Cultural Heritage Site by Unesco. Among Gardel´s unforgettable tangoes Mi Buenos Aires querido, Amores de estudiante, Mi noche triste and Por una cabeza that accompanied the most beautiful scenes of films such as All the King´s Men, True Lies, Schindler´s List, Scent of a Woman and Frida.
The evening will be presented by the beautiful actress Anna Safroncik and will also feature Esmeralda Sahoni Camarena .
Special Guest of the evening will be the legendary Fred Bongusto who will tread the stage to enchant the audience with Una rotonda sul mare and the singer-songwriter's other sixties and seventies hits.
Also announced is the presence of Valeria Marini who will showcase Seduzioni Diamonds by Valeria Marini fashion creations on the runway.
A star-studded parterre and a great show to concretely support the HHF Onlus scientific research program, which, with proceeds from admissions, will to fund the recently inaugurated Institute of Human Health Biosciences in Terni.
The event was sponsored by theEuropean Parliamentary Observatory and the Council of Europe and theArgentine Embassy in Italy and is sponsored from Califin and the newspaper La Notte.

HHF / Human Health Foundation Onlus®

Founded in 2006 by the President of Banca Popolare di Spoleto, Giovannino Antonini and Professor Antonio Giordano, an internationally renowned scientist is a nonprofit organization with the purpose of promoting health to for the benefit of the community. Professor Antonio Giorda-no, a professor of human pathology and oncology at the University of Siena and director of the SHRO/Sbarro Institute for Cancer Research and Molecular Medicine in Philadelphia/USA, coordinates the Terni/Terni Human Health Bioscience Institute, created by HHF Onlus to be a hub of scientific excellence for South Central Italy.
